quote:

From 1993 – 1999 while at Louisiana Tech, Conque served as Offensive Coordinator, Running Backs Coach, Special Teams Coordinator and Recruiting Coordinator. During the 1999 season with Conque as Offensive Coordinator, Louisiana Tech went 8-3 and ranked first in the nation in passing offense – averaging 403 yards per game. The Bulldogs were also second in the nation in total offense and averaged 37 points a game. Among their triumphs were back-to-back victories over Alabama (26-20 in 1997 and 29-28 in 1999), Mississippi State and the University of California.
